A Cryptocurrency Trading Platform Suspends IPO Plans Due to Difficult Market Conditions

Gate News Report, March 18 — A certain cryptocurrency trading platform has suspended its IPO plans due to challenging market conditions. In November last year, the platform announced that it had secretly submitted a draft registration statement on Form S-1 to the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) for its proposed common stock initial public offering (IPO). The number of shares to be issued and the price range have not yet been determined. The IPO was originally scheduled to take place after the SEC completed its review process and was contingent on market and other conditions.
